Experimental GUHA procedures
Kuchař, Tomáš ; Mrázová, Iveta (referee) ; Rauch, Jan (advisor)
The goal of this work is a new implementation of six GUHA procedures known from LISpMiner system (4ftMiner, SD4ft-Miner, CFMiner, SDCFMiner, KLMiner, SDKLMiner) into Ferda Data Miner system environment with respect to their futher research and development. GUHA procedure automatically generates patterns from user defined set of relevant patterns and tests if it is true in the analysed data. The output of the procedure consists of all prime patterns. The pattern is prime if it is true in the analysed data and if it does not immediately follow from the other more simple output patterns. Typical effective implementation of a GUHA procedure uses suitable database representation by bit strings. Tools were created for solving above-mentioned GUHA procedures. Variants of translation of German compounds into Czech (illustrated with translation of economic texts)
VONÁŠKOVÁ, Jiřina
There are lot of variants how to translate German compounds into Czech. The reason is that in German the composition takes the most important place among the word-forming pattern. In Czech the main word-forming pattern is the derivation. This is the reason, why it is not possible to translate German compound into Czech by using the compound. The aim of the work is to create the summary of variants on the basis of analysis of economic texts. The texts are professional, so it is not possible to omit the terms, because the terms are the main charakterisctic of technical language.

Manager´s personality development and human resources management
KOREŠOVÁ, Pavla
The aim of this thesis is to explore new approaches and perspectivities on manager´s personality development and manager´s personality in contemporary human resources management. In the theoretical part of this thesis were summarized issues of human resources management, knowledge management, manager´s personality and its development. The selected research methodology was a questionnaire survey. The research was focused on the forces that determine the manager´s personality and his own opinions and preferences. The questionnaire was filled in by a total of 73 respondents. In consideration came the division into four categories depending on where company executives are found. These categories were public administration, financial services companies, transport and accommodation services companies and manufacturing enterprises. The data were evaluated separately for each category and made into tables and graphs which were followed by partial results and discussions on individual issues. Based on the results we can say that we are moving to a situation where the leadership positions will discover a balanced representation of men and women relating to higher education and good language skills. Most managers feel the need for further education and they are actively working on it. The most prefered form of learning is learning through education courses, learning from the other managers and from their own experiences. It is clear that managers prefer to work in teams, consultative and team style of management, self-realization, adequate earnings and friendly relations in the workplace. As prerequisite for successful management is considered organizational and communication skills, ability to motivate people and take responsibility for their decisions. Most executives have the oportunity to come up with creative ideas and more than half of them enforce it into practice. After a summary of the informations gathered, it becomes clear tendency of manager not to be afraid of new approaches in education and personality development, which is on a very good level. Today´s managers are aware of the imporatnce of education for the knowledge society, and they are trying actively to develope it. In the future we can expect more sophisticated styles of management and upward trend in the implementation of new personnel management in all the monitored sectors.
